What you’ll do:

Here is a sample for some of what your workdays may look like:

 

  • Review, draft and negotiate contracts, and provide general advice and legal support for NorthRiver’s business.
  • Support and collaborate with business functions on all legal aspects of NorthRiver’s business, including commercial, operations, corporate finance, mergers and acquisitions, human resources, procurement, and litigation.
  • Live by the NorthRiver values and showcase those values to all stakeholders.    
  • Negotiate, review and action a variety of diverse transactions such as acquisitions and divestitures, joint ventures, project development and complex financings.
  • Negotiate, draft, and review of a wide variety of complex commercial contracts, including gas processing agreements, commodity purchase and sale arrangements, infrastructure arrangements, project development agreements, and various lease arrangements.
  • Deliver legal advice concerning deal structures, due diligence and post-closing assimilation.
  • Provide timely and responsive client service.
  • Assist in matters pertaining to corporate governance, which includes support for board and committee meetings, safeguarding company records and ensuring adherence to all local, provincial, federal, and industry-specific laws, regulations and NorthRiver policies.
  • Review supply chain management and construction contracts and provide support, guidance, legal advice and drafting.
  • Advise on legal issues and risks, contract approval processes, policies and procedures and litigation matters.
  • Review and identify legal trends and risks as part of the changing regulatory environment.

What you bring:

Required

  • 3+ years of post-call experience related to corporate and commercial, regulatory, or banking and finance legal work, with experience in the energy sector an asset.
  • JD or LLB from a recognized university is a requirement with current standing to practice law in Canada and the ability to be or become a practicing member of the Law Society of Alberta.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Proficient in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ook.
  • Knowledge of the energy industry an asset.
  • Robust negotiation and decision-making abilities.
  • Strong and effective written and verbal negotiation and communication skills.
  • Excellent legal drafting skills and attention to detail.
  • Ability to navigate a fast-paced, dynamic environment and manage numerous projects concurrently.
  • Demonstrated ability to collaborate with a variety of people and job functions within the organization internally and externally.
  • Strong commercial/business acumen and a pragmatic approach to legal issues and advice.
  • Strong organizational skills and an ability to support diverse client groups.
  • Demonstrated ability to complete legal tasks within tight deadlines and work independently.
  • Understanding of policy and regulatory requirements and associated risks.
